The big turnoff
Due to a crash, and an ensuing heatwave I was forced to turn off my mining. The crash happened with my mining rig in the kitchen, and my two 2060 super cards. And due to the heatwave and the crazy high electricity price, I did not have the energy to mess with them and troubleshoot.
By 3060 that is in my PC, I also turned off. But not because it was not running ok, but due to the heat being created and the fact I am sleeping in the same room. =/
My friend graciously offered to have the cards running at his place, meaning I could ship them or drop them off when I visited him next time. Which was as good a reason as ever to visit him. What I ended up doing instead, after talking to him about it. Was swapping out my 2060 supers for two RX 5700 XT cards.
So two for two, seems even, right? Well yes and no. This allowed me to sell my 2060 cards, and then buy the new RX 5700 XT cards. And have them be shipped directly to my friend. I will still visit him the next time I am on the west coast. ;) This also achieved another thing, it actually increased my hashrate by a little, but more importantly. It allows me to continue to mine and do so more efficiently. Meaning I get more hashrate for less electricity.
And while I took a slightly bigger financial hit with selling the 2060 and buying the 5700 than I liked I still think this will be better in the long run. And I do plan on continuing to mine even after The Merge. And while 2060 tends to perform slightly better mining different coins, I think the efficiency gained will compensate me. At least that is the plan. =)
And my friend having a much cheaper price for his electricity will also save me a pretty penny or two.
And while the electricity still is crazy high for me, I plan to turn on my 3060 in what hopefully will be the near future. As soon as the weather allows it.
